LOVE IS VULNERABLE

LOVE IS VULNERABLE

Reaching out and touching someone always runs the risk of pain. My love will put you in places of danger; danger of heartache, danger of loss, and even physical danger and possible loss of life. The work of My spirit in you, destroys the flesh, which is the self preserving part, of your being. When this part is removed, My love is is able to take you places that you would never be willing to go in the flesh. 

It will expose you to people who will not appreciate My love, and think nothing of taking advantage of you. I displayed the ultimate vulnerability of My love on the cross. Love displayed, where love is returned is no test of love at all. Love displayed, where love is spurned is agape love. Passing this test is where you can count it all joy. This is My love, that causes the laying down of your life. 

It is supernatural and will destroy enemy forces with simple acts of kindness. Never underestimate the power of My love, where a simple word can change a life forever. A single sentence spoken at the perfect moment can go to the heart and revolutionize a person forever. That love power will be mocked, lied too, played for a fool, and stolen from, but My love can stand it, and never fails to come up the winner. Do not feel any loss over these negative actions because they bring great rewards.  

When you display My love you never loose. If it is received, you are rewarded and if it rejected, you are rewarded. Whenever someone steals from you don't say,"I been robbed", say, "I been blessed". In my love is complete rest, knowing that all is well at all times, because at the end of this test, you win. Love never fails!

Keeping My love pure is a major challenge for the sold out believer because they are 100%ers. When I give a directive to display My love in a specific way, you must stay within My guide lines. The tendency is to go beyond, which puts you into flesh and you doing things by your emotion and your own physical strength, not My Spirit. My love works with My plan and and timing, if you rush ahead or lag behind you will lack My power and anointing. When I say, "give two" your enthusiasm will say, more is better, and you are tempted to give three. Disobedience is disobedience on the plus or the minus side. However it is better to err on the plus side. I can curb your emotions easier than melt a selfish heart.

Now take all your past hurts, pains, emotional bruises, where My love has been stomped on, and trampled under foot, and praise Me for them, because for each one, you have a great reward waiting. The joy is still set before you so keep watch for the next person I send to you, to display My love. Guard your heart to keep it pure and it will bring for much fruit.

  1 Corinthians 13:1-13 (AMP)
IF I can speak in the tongues of men and even of angels, but have not love (that reasoning, intentional, spiritual devotion such as is inspired by God''s love for and in us), I am only a noisy gong or a clanging cymbal. [2] And if I have prophetic powers (the gift of interpreting the divine will and purpose), and understand all the secret truths and mysteries and possess all knowledge, and if I have sufficient faith so that I can remove mountains, but have not love (God''s love in me) I am nothing (a useless nobody). [3] Even if I dole out all that I have to the poor in providing food, and if I surrender my body to be burned or in order that I may glory, but have not love (God''s love in me), I gain nothing. [4] Love endures long and is patient and kind; love never is envious nor boils over with jealousy, is not boastful or vainglorious, does not display itself haughtily. [5] It is not conceited (arrogant and inflated with pride); it is not rude (unmannerly) and does not act unbecomingly. Love (God''s love in us) does not insist on its own rights or its own way, for it is not self-seeking; it is not touchy or fretful or resentful; it takes no account of the evil done to it it pays no attention to a suffered wrong. [6] It does not rejoice at injustice and unrighteousness, but rejoices when right and truth prevail. [7] Love bears up under anything and everything that comes, is ever ready to believe the best of every person, its hopes are fadeless under all circumstances, and it endures everything without weakening. [8] Love never fails never fades out or becomes obsolete or comes to an end. As for prophecy (the gift of interpreting the divine will and purpose), it will be fulfilled and pass away; as for tongues, they will be destroyed and cease; as for knowledge, it will pass away it will lose its value and be superseded by truth. [9] For our knowledge is fragmentary (incomplete and imperfect), and our prophecy (our teaching) is fragmentary (incomplete and imperfect). [10] But when the complete and perfect (total) comes, the incomplete and imperfect will vanish away (become antiquated, void, and superseded). [11] When I was a child, I talked like a child, I thought like a child, I reasoned like a child; now that I have become a man, I am done with childish ways and have put them aside. [12] For now we are looking in a mirror that gives only a dim (blurred) reflection of reality as in a riddle or enigma, but then when perfection comes we shall see in reality and face to face! Now I know in part (imperfectly), but then I shall know and understand fully and clearly, even in the same manner as I have been fully and clearly known and understood by God. [13] And so faith, hope, love abide faith--conviction and belief respecting man''s relation to God and divine things; hope--joyful and confident expectation of eternal salvation; love--true affection for God and man, growing out of God''s love for and in us, these three; but the greatest of these is love.
